Health Informatics Program Manager

Aptive Resources
Posted 6 hours ago
🇺🇸United States🏠Remote📁Healthcare/Clinical
Is this job info correct?

Job Summary Aptive is seeking a Health Informatics Program Manager to lead several engineering projects for the Veterans Health Administration. The ideal candidate will have experience leading software engineering, data and test teams and an interest in improving our healthcare system through data science applied across patient safety, policy, usability, clinical and revenue cycle domains. Using their informatics expertise, the Health Informatics Program Manager will influence internal and federal leadership teams as a trusted advisor with a focus on improving healthcare operations and clinical outcomes. The position offers stimulating advanced analytics activities (AI/ML), in a rich healthcare environment. This position is remote but requires periodic travel to Aptive’s Alexandria, Virginia headquarters. Primary Responsibilities Lead Aptive’s health informatics programs working with government entities to apply data science, decision intelligence, and analytics to transform healthcare operations and improve patient outcomes. Guide, mentor, and lead a senior data team ensuring interoperability standards, security, and general requirements are met Collect, elaborate, and manage requirements from customers - actively participate in setting up and managing new studies Set technical direction, manage schedules, resources and customer satisfaction Inform leadership and subordinates on technical tools, methodologies, and resources used for conducting studies and analyzing classified and unclassified information Lead team in the application of operations research techniques and in-depth knowledge of data science techniques and methodologies such as machine learning, predictive analysis, prescriptive analysis and optimization, and other emerging analytical technique Plan, forecast, identify, and define major problems and future needs, seeks root causes, develops practical courses of action and timely solutions and identifies opportunities for significant process enhancements and recommended changes Evaluate the performance of decision systems, models, and tools; involves peers and team members in analyzing strengths and weaknesses in performance, and spearheads pilots and planned functional or technical change initiatives Manage relationship with VA clients and strategic partners Minimum Qualifications 15+ years of professional experience and domain expertise in Health Informatics, Health IT, and/or Clinical Informatics Expert level skill across Python, R, SQL, Java, Julia, Scala and applications like SPSS, SAS 5+ years of advanced data analysis (AI/ML) experience Strong experience working with data and AI/ML platforms (Azure ML, AWS AI/ML, DataBricks, Palantir, SnowFlakes, etc.) Expertise in software/big data tools: Hadoop, Spark, and Kafka Proficiency in visualization tools (PowerApps, PowerBI, Looker, Metabase, Tableau, seaborn, etc.) Excellent problem-solving, collaboration and communication (verbal and writing) skills with fluency in MS Office. Passion for continuous learning as data science evolves. Healthcare, research, and consulting experience preferred PhD / Masters / BS degree in data science, statistics, or computer/information science or similar area a minimum Desired Qualifications Expertise in Electronic Health Record Management (EHRM) system integration and support Direct experience supporting the Department of Veterans Affairs and/or Veterans Health Administration About Aptive Aptive is a modern federal consulting firm focused on human experience, digital services, and business transformation. We harness creativity, technology, and culture to connect people and systems to impact the world. We’re advisors, strategists, and engineers focused on people, above all else. We believe in generating success collaboratively, leaving client organizations stronger after every engagement and building trust for the next big challenge.
